United Auto Workers flyers, [1935]
According to his unpublished memoir, Brinnin met Walter Reuther in Detroit during the formation of the United Auto Workers. At the age of nineteen Brinnin did office work and distributed flyers. His memoir chronicles the first sit-down strike in Detroit.

"John Malcolm Brinnin" video cassette, [1990s]
Video cassette of an interview with Brinnin in Key West, Florida. Brinnin comments on his decision to live in Key West, Truman Capote, his works on passenger ships, writers living in Key West, and Dylan Thomas. The interview is obviously edited with live shots of Brinnin intermixed with images of his books and is approximately five minutes in length.
Audio cassette of Brinnin reading his poetry for Boston's radio show "Sunday Anthology", [1970s]
Hosted by Valerie Henderson, the show features Brinnin reading poems from his Selected Poems and Skin Diving in the Virgins. The show was produced while Brinnin was a professor at Boston University.
